Этот баннер — требование Роскомнадзора для исполнения 152 ФЗ.
«На сайте осуществляется обработка файлов cookie, необходимых для работы сайта, а также для анализа использования сайта и улучшения предоставляемых сервисов с использованием метрической программы Яндекс.Метрика. Продолжая использовать сайт, вы даёте согласие с использованием данных технологий».
Политика конфиденциальности
|
|
|
MessageBox в asp.net
|
|||
|---|---|---|---|
|
#18+
Подскажите пожалуйста: есть приложение на асп.нет фреймворк 1, по таймеру запускается хранимая процедура, которая проверяет таблицу на изменение. и если изменения были - выводит месажбокс. Так вот, в этом месажбоксе и проблема. если использовать messagebox.show("сообщение") то вылетает ошибка: it is invalid to show a modal dialog or form when the application is not running in userinteractivemode. specify the servicenotification or defaultdeskonly style to display a notification from a service application как поступить?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 03.08.2006, 10:11 |
|
||
|
MessageBox в asp.net
|
|||
|---|---|---|---|
|
#18+
Учим матчасть---------------------------------------- Knowledge is P...O...w...E...R! My site 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 03.08.2006, 10:33 |
|
||
|
MessageBox в asp.net
|
|||
|---|---|---|---|
|
#18+
Ты не можешь использовать классы Windows Forms в своем Web Appliation! Для вывода всяких message box, используй JavaScript : alert-------------------------- ..keep your code tidy.. -------------------------- 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 03.08.2006, 10:36 |
|
||
|
MessageBox в asp.net
|
|||
|---|---|---|---|
|
#18+
javascript понятно, но как из кода создать яваскрипт и передать его клиенту и там выполнить????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 03.08.2006, 10:37 |
|
||
|
MessageBox в asp.net
|
|||
|---|---|---|---|
|
#18+
RegisterStartupScript 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 03.08.2006, 10:40 |
|
||
|
MessageBox в asp.net
|
|||
|---|---|---|---|
|
#18+
и что с ней делать???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 03.08.2006, 10:43 |
|
||
|
MessageBox в asp.net
|
|||
|---|---|---|---|
|
#18+
Доброго времени суток господа! На сайте RSDN.ru есть статья где реализован класс, который в свою очередь и использует alert(""), я этот класс использую, лично мне нравится 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 03.08.2006, 11:03 |
|
||
|
MessageBox в asp.net
|
|||
|---|---|---|---|
|
#18+
а как тот же самый класс реализовать на VB.NET? он там реализован на с#, или как этот класс подключить к проекту на vb.net http://rsdn.ru/Forum/Info.aspx?name=FAQ.aspnet.messagebox 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 03.08.2006, 11:06 |
|
||
|
MessageBox в asp.net
|
|||
|---|---|---|---|
|
#18+
2Lokk:и что с ней делать??? Вот тебе заготовка, этот класс в апликухе для теста, так-что могут быть баги . /// <summary> /// Erzeugt einen MessageBox als JavaScript alert() /// /// <example> /// <code> /// <HEAD> /// ..... ///<script language="JavaScript"> /// <!-- /// function MessageBoxShow(){;} /// --> ///</script> ///</HEAD> ///<body onload="javascript:MessageBoxShow();">...</body> /// ///private void Page_Load(object sender, System.EventArgs e) ///{ /// try /// { /// ... /// } /// catch(Exception ex) /// { /// MessageBox.Show(this,ex.Message); /// } ///} /// ///</code> ///</example> /// </summary> public class MessageBox { public static void Show(System.Web.UI.UserControl parent,string message) { Show(parent,"MessageBoxShow",message); } public static void Show(System.Web.UI.UserControl parent,string functionName,string message) { if (parent != null && parent.Page != null) { Show(parent.Page,functionName,message); } } public static void Show(System.Web.UI.Page parent,string message) { Show(parent,"MessageBoxShow",message); } public static void Show(System.Web.UI.Page parent,string functionName,string message) { if (parent != null) { parent.RegisterStartupScript(functionName,"<script language=\"JavaScript\"> function "+functionName+" (){ alert('"+message.Replace("\\","\\\\").Replace("\r\n","\\n").Replace("'","\\'")+"');} </script>"); } } } -- Если тебе помогли, незабудь сказать спасибо -- -- Это всё мое личное мнение которое может не совпадать с Вашим или может быть ошибочным -- .NetCoder 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 03.08.2006, 11:16 |
|
||
|
MessageBox в asp.net
|
|||
|---|---|---|---|
|
#18+
как же все это реализовать на VB.net?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 03.08.2006, 11:30 |
|
||
|
MessageBox в asp.net
|
|||
|---|---|---|---|
|
#18+
так как же реализовать на VB.Net?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 03.08.2006, 11:31 |
|
||
|
MessageBox в asp.net
|
|||
|---|---|---|---|
|
#18+
как же все это реализовать на VB.net? Перепиши сам. Но легче, как уже сказали, воспользоваться Page.RegisterStartupScript Page.RegisterStartupScript("MsgBox", "<script language=\"javascript\">\n<!-- \n function window.onload()\n"+ "{ alert('"+Mess+"'); \n }\n//-->\n</script>"); Я думаю одну строчку переписать на VB намного проще... При желании можешь и функцию на VBScript переписать 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 03.08.2006, 12:55 |
|
||
|
MessageBox в asp.net
|
|||
|---|---|---|---|
|
#18+
Если нужен MessageBox на сервере его можно отобразить так: MessageBox.Show("Test", "Test", MessageBoxButtons.OK, MessageBoxIcon.Information, MessageBoxDefaultButton.Button1, MessageBoxOptions.ServiceNotification); Обратите внимание на последний параметр.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 03.08.2006, 15:26 |
|
||
|
|

start [/forum/topic.php?fid=18&msg=33897974&tid=1390997]: |
0ms |
get settings: |
9ms |
get forum list: |
21ms |
check forum access: |
3ms |
check topic access: |
3ms |
track hit: |
136ms |
get topic data: |
8ms |
get forum data: |
3ms |
get page messages: |
51ms |
get tp. blocked users: |
1ms |
| others: | 268ms |
| total: | 503ms |

| 0 / 0 |
